On the 8 of June Google announcing the completion of a new web indexing system called Caffeine. Caffeine provides 50 percent fresher results for web searches than our last index, and it's the largest collection of web content we've offered. Whether it's a news story, a blog or a forum post, you can now find links to relevant content much sooner after it is published than was possible ever before
Many peopl have asked is it easy to add a "Follow Me On Twitter" button to a website. Its actuall very simple. First you add a button to hte page. The button is an image you want people to click on and then you add a link to the button. The link to send some one to your twitter would be "http://twitter.com/username" . You need to replace the "username" with your own twitter username.
